This Reliance Jio plan offers unlimited calling, free 4G data for 6 months

The new Reliance Jio plan offers unlimited voice and data for a period of six months.

NEW DELHI: The JioPhone Monsoon Hungama offer was announced by the Reliance Jio last week. Under the offer, mobile subscribers using feature phone of any brand can exchange it with new JioPhone for an effective price of Rs 501. Along with the JioPhone exchange offer, Reliance Jio has also announced a special recharge plan, which comes at the cost of Rs 594. The Rs. 594 plan provides 6-month validity, and the amount will be paid at the time of activation of the JioPhone. The plan bundles data, call, and message benefits. It offers unlimited voice and data for a period of six months. There’s a daily cap of 500MB on data usage under the Rs 594 plan. Reliance Jio is also providing a coupon of Rs 101 giving 6GB data additionally. The Rs 594 recharge pack offers 84GB data in total for six months and 6GB additional data takes total data to 90GB over six months. "As part of JioPhone Monsoon Hungama Offer, you need to make an upfront payment of Rs. 501 as refundable security deposit for new JioPhone. You will also get a special JioPhone Recharge Plan of Unlimited Voice & Data for 6 months on paying only Rs 594 at the time of activation. Additionally, you will also get a special exchange bonus of 6GB data voucher, worth Rs 101. You will get a total of 90 GB data over 6 months," the company said. You can exchange any 2G, 3G, 4G (non-VOLTE) phone which is not older than January 1st 2015, to avail this offer. You need to ensure that the existing phone and its charger are both are undamaged and in working condition. The new JioPhone comes with a Jio SIM. You may also port-in your existing number via MNP process. To avail this offer, customers need to visit their Jio Retailer or nearest Jio Store.
